PALATKA, Fla., Nov. 9, 2021 — The St. Johns River Water Management District’s Governing Board today elected Rob Bradley to serve as its Chairman through November 2022. The Board also elected Maryam Ghyabi-White to serve as Vice Chairman, Chris Peterson as Secretary and Ron Howse as Treasurer.

The other board members are immediate past-Chairman Douglas Burnett, Ryan Atwood, Doug Bournique, Janet Price and Cole Oliver.

Board members, who meet monthly, are responsible for setting the policies for the District’s operation. They are appointed by the governor to four-year terms and serve without pay.
